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1957331 04 46 09830646219
0911556 1630923385
0911556 1630923385
644177 10405359275 4955867036
All about undefined
Interested in learning more?
0911556 1630923385
644177 10405359275 4955867036
See more
707324 01192365583
83640651 3066 36 0897 820552
See more
331654039 3997537552
26 79517 2644065 7470133
See more